Widespread tightening of bot detection and client-side fingerprinting produces non-obvious revenue leakage for any digital business that monetizes anonymous or semi-anonymous traffic. Expect a measurable drop in programmatic ad fill rates and click-through-derived signals over the next 1-3 quarters as anti-bot rules err on the side of false positives; publishers and smaller ad-tech stacks will see gross CPMs fall while negotiated direct-sold inventory holds up better. For e-commerce, a 1-3% increase in checkout friction from additional JavaScript/cookie prompts translates to a 3-7% hit to conversion rates in the first month, with a portion recovering as UX/engineering teams optimize around new constraints. The immediate winners are vendors that can front-run the tradeoff between accuracy and UX: edge/CDN providers and specialized bot-management/security firms that can do mitigation without full-page friction. Second-order beneficiaries include server-side analytics and first-party data tooling (fewer sampled signals => premium on clean, consented telemetry). Losers include small publishers, ad-tech middlemen that rely on client-side fingerprinting for identity stitching, and macro quant/data firms dependent on large-scale scraping—those workflows will face higher costs or lower coverage within weeks. Key risks and catalysts: regulator pushback (GDPR/CCPA) against stealth fingerprinting could force reversals over 6-24 months, restoring some scraped signals but increasing compliance costs. A rapid vendor consolidation cycle is plausible within 9-18 months as large CDNs bundle bot-management into platform deals, compressing margins for niche vendors. Monitor three near-term indicators: changes in organic search indexing rates (SEO crawler access), programmatic CPM trends for mid-tail publishers, and reported bot-mitigation revenue growth in CDN/security guidance.
